INDUSTRIAL SALT MARKET OVERVIEW

The global Industrial Salt Market was valued at USD 13.73 billion in 2024 and is projected to reach USD 13.92 billion in 2025, steadily progressing to USD 15.56 billion by 2033, with a CAGR of 1.4% from 2025 to 2033.

Industrial salt is fundamental to a number of industries, such as: water treatment, food processing, chemicals, and de-icing. Industrial salt in the form of sodium chloride (NaCl) is generally an intermediate to produce chlorine, caustic soda (sodium hydroxide) and soda ash in an industrial way. INDUSTRIAL SALT MARKET KEY FINDINGS

  • MARKET SIZE AND GROWTH - The worldwide industrial salt market is expected to reach USD 16.27 billion by 2033 and increase from USD 13.73 billion in 2024.
  • KEY MARKET DRIVER - In 2023 in the United States, the chemical industry represented ≈38 % of the overall salt sales which indicates that salt is a crucial ingredient in the chlor-alkali manufacturing of caustic soda. 
  • MAJOR MARKET RESTRAINT - The environmental regulations for extracting salt are becoming stricter which is raising costs and reducing production in some of the largest producing locations.
  • EMERGING TRENDS - Asia Pacific industrialization is moving quickly while the use of solar evaporation and solution-mining techniques are starting to be adopted by salt manufacturers to achieve purity.
  • REAGIONAL LEADERSHIP - In 2023, 53 million tons of salt were produced in China, followed by India with 30 million tons. This highlights the Asia Pacific's leading role.
  • COMPETETIVE LANDSCAPE - Some of the market leaders are: Cargill, Compass Minerals, Tata Chemicals, K+S AG, INEOS Salt, and China National Salt Industry Corporation
  • MARKET SEGMENTATION - In the U.S. in 2023, 46 % of salt sold was rock salt, salt in brine was 33 %, vacuum pan salt was 11 %, and solar salt was 10 %.
  • RECENT DEVELOPMENT - In 2023, there are 63 salt plants owned by 25 companies in 16 states, with the top 7 states producing ≈95 % of the national total.

INDUSTRIAL SALT MARKET SEGMENTATION

BY TYPE

Based on Type, the global market can be categorized into Sea Salt, Well and Rock Salt, Lake Salt

  • Sea Salt: Produced through natural evaporation of seawater, sea salt is a versatile raw material with various industrial applications. As a source of minerals that can be used in manufacturing and is often the preferred style, especially in chemical processing. Sea salt's manufacturing practices depend heavily upon weather and climate, especially in coasting areas of the world. Other limitations may be posed by environmental concerns or space for production.
  • Well and Rock Salt: Collected from underground deposits, well and rock salt is processed through mining or solution mining. Rock salt and well salt are among the highest abundances of sodium chloride in raw forms, making it common in de-icing and as an ingredient in chemicals. Rock salt is often considered the preferred choice by many countries who are de-icing roads during the winter months. However, mining activities may be subject to regulation and environmental constraints.
  • Lake Salt: Lake salt is made from salt lakes or brine from inland sources by solar evaporation or mechanical processing. This style of salt can be raw materials for supply chain agents consuming livestock feed additives, procedures for food manufacturing process, and even chemical manufacturing sources in a hybrid source requirement. The availability of either lake salt or brine typically rely on geographic conditions, as well as salinity concentration of brine. The growing emphasis on sustainable means of extraction, as well as industry developments will dictate prospects for growth for lake salt.

BY APPLICATION

Based on application, the global market can be categorized into Chemical Processing, De-Icing, Oil & Gas, Water Treatment, Agriculture

  • Chemical Processing: The largest application of industrial salt is in chemical processing, which uses salt primarily as a feedstock for chlorine, caustic soda and soda ash. These chemicals are used in many different industries including plastics, textiles, and pharmaceuticals, all of which drive ongoing demand for salt as a commodity thus leading to stable consumption of salt, and a major disruption to the chemical industry will likely Impact the overall Industrial Salt market with respect to consumption of salt.
  • De-Icing:  In regions with winter weather, industrial salt is heavily used as a de-icing agent on roads and highways to help reduce traffic accidents. Rock salt has been the most common as it is the least expensive and abundantly available. The demand for de-icing salt is seasonal, and can significantly increase in instances of multiple snow events in one month. There is a strong correlation when climate variability is considered around market size; this may further expand moving forward into uncertainties associated with climate variability.
  • Oil & Gas:  Industrial salt is an additive in drilling fluids and completion fluids. Oil companies use industrial salt in drilling and completion fluids for several reasons: to increase the density of fluids being used in a wellbore (thus controlling pressure); to stabilize boreholes, permitting wellbore to stabilize; and because salt is effective when put into a drilling fluid because it controls wellbore instability and inhibits formation damage. There can be an influence of salt demand by the oil and gas sector based on salt's performance, especially considering gear swings in drilling activity over a typical exploratory cycle. Crude oil price fluctuations can significantly affect the salt demand in this segment.
  • Water Treatment: Salt is part of the water softening and treatment process in municipal and industrial water treatment facilities. Salt is used to regenerate ion exchange resins in softeners that remove calcium and magnesium. As clean water awareness grows and regulatory constraints tighten, this sector will stay steady. Technology has also improved salt consumption efficiency in treatment systems.
  • Agriculture: In agriculture, industrial salt can be used in livestock feed, or included in soil enhancers, to support livestock health and soil nutrient absorption. Salt can also be used in specialty weed control products, and in some cases will manage soil salinity. Demand for salt in agriculture is stable, but varies regionally and based on farming practices. Plants from sustainably-focused farming practices are urging controlled use of salt while maximizing efficiency.

Market Growth Driven by Renewable Energy and Thermal Storage Demand

Opportunity

One emerging opportunity for growth in the industrial salt market is in the area of renewable energy development, particularly solar power. Additionally, industrial salt is used in molten salt thermal energy storage systems that improve the energy efficiency of solar power plants. As countries are focusing more on clean energy, demand for those storage assist solutions will also grow. The opportunity provides new and a growing area to utilize industrial salt and the trend not only favors market expansion but also aligns with global sustainability initiatives.

Market Growth Challenged by Raw Material and Transportation Cost Fluctuations

Challenge

A key challenge in the industrial market is the fluctuation in the cost of raw materials and transportation. Because salt tends to be heavy and is not valuable per unit, high logistic costs can erode profitability quickly. Coupled with the global supply chain disruptions that could come from events such as the COVID-19 pandemic, the timing and ability to deliver on salt can be difficult to predict, and may not be stable in pricing. As a result, producers and end users can have a hard time maintaining regular deliveries and prices.

KEY INDUSTRY DEVELOPMENT

March 2025: Cargill launched a new high-purity industrial salt product under its "Clear Point™" line specifically designed for the chemical manufacturing and the water treatment industry. The product had improved solubility with less insolubles, making it preferable to use when brine consistency is important. This was part of Cargill's continuing efforts to provide industrial customers with smarter and better salt solutions. According to the company, ClearPoint™ was produced using better methods of refining at Cargill's upgraded facility in Watkins Glen, New York that recently updated its processes to keep pace with the evolving industry standards.
